Benjamin Thomas THORPE

Regimental number1184
Place of birthTumby Bay, South Australia
SchoolPort Elliston Public School, South Australia
ReligionChurch of England
OccupationLabourer
AddressPenong, South Australia
Marital statusSingle
Age at embarkation24.6
Height5' 10.75"
Weight175 lbs
Next of kinFather, T Thorpe, Penong, South Australia
Previous military serviceMember for 2 weeks, Tumby Bay Rifle Club
Enlistment date14 September 1914
Place of enlistmentMorphettville, South Australia
Rank on enlistmentPrivate
Unit name10th Battalion, 1st Reinforcement
AWM Embarkation Roll number23/27/2
Embarkation detailsUnit embarked from Melbourne, Victoria, on board HMAT Themistocles on 7 December 1914
Rank from Nominal RollPrivate
Unit from Nominal Roll10th Battalion
FateKilled in Action 19 May 1915
Place of burialShrapnel Valley Cemetery (Plot III, Row D, Grave No. 23), Gallipoli, Turkey
Panel number, Roll of Honour,
  Australian War Memorial
60
Miscellaneous information from
  cemetery records
Parents: Thomas and Rose Ann THORPE. Native of Port Lincoln, South Australia
Other details

War service: Egypt, Gallipoli

Medals: 1914-15 Star, British War Medal, Victory Medal
